引言
随着互联网技术的不断发展,用户对网页的交互性和视觉效果提出了更高的要求。jQuery卡片插件作为一种流行的网页设计元素,能够轻松实现炫酷的动态效果,为网页增添活力。本文将深入探讨jQuery卡片插件的特点、使用方法以及如何将其应用于实际项目中。
一、jQuery卡片插件概述
1.1 什么是jQuery卡片插件?
jQuery卡片插件是一种基于jQuery库的网页组件,通过简单的HTML、CSS和JavaScript代码,可以实现卡片翻转、滑动、折叠等动态效果。它广泛应用于产品展示、图片轮播、导航菜单等场景。
1.2 jQuery卡片插件的优势
- 易于使用:无需复杂的编程知识,通过简单的API调用即可实现各种效果。
- 跨平台兼容性:支持主流浏览器,如Chrome、Firefox、Safari等。
- 高度可定制:可以通过CSS和JavaScript进行个性化定制,满足不同需求。
二、jQuery卡片插件的使用方法
2.1 引入jQuery库
在使用jQuery卡片插件之前,首先需要在HTML文件中引入jQuery库。可以通过以下代码实现:
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
2.2 引入卡片插件
接下来,需要引入jQuery卡片插件的CSS和JavaScript文件。以下是一个示例:
<link rel="stylesheet" href="path/to/card-plugin.css">
<script src="path/to/card-plugin.js"></script>
2.3 HTML结构
根据需求,设计HTML结构。以下是一个简单的卡片结构示例:
<div class="card">
<div class="card-inner">
<div class="card-front">
<h2>标题</h2>
<p>描述</p>
</div>
<div class="card-back">
<h2>背面内容</h2>
<p>更多描述</p>
</div>
</div>
</div>
2.4 初始化卡片插件
在HTML文件中,通过以下代码初始化卡片插件:
$(document).ready(function() {
$('.card').card({
// 配置项
});
});
2.5 配置项
根据需求,可以设置多种配置项,如动画效果、触发方式等。以下是一些常用配置项:
transition: 设置卡片翻转的动画效果,如flip,slide,fade等。easing: 设置动画的缓动函数。trigger: 设置触发卡片翻转的事件,如hover,click等。
三、jQuery卡片插件的应用实例
3.1 产品展示
以下是一个使用jQuery卡片插件实现的产品展示示例:
<div class="card">
<div class="card-inner">
<div class="card-front">
<img src="path/to/image1.jpg" alt="产品1">
</div>
<div class="card-back">
<h2>产品1</h2>
<p>这里是产品1的描述</p>
</div>
</div>
</div>
3.2 图片轮播
以下是一个使用jQuery卡片插件实现图片轮播的示例:
<div class="card">
<div class="card-inner">
<div class="card-front">
<img src="path/to/image1.jpg" alt="图片1">
</div>
<div class="card-back">
<img src="path/to/image2.jpg" alt="图片2">
</div>
</div>
</div>
四、总结
jQuery卡片插件作为一种强大的网页设计工具,能够轻松实现炫酷的动态效果,为网页增添活力。通过本文的介绍,相信您已经对jQuery卡片插件有了深入的了解。在实际项目中,可以根据需求灵活运用,打造出独具特色的网页效果。
